**FAQ: How do I access the first-aid room?**

The first-aid room at Dunmore Place is on the first floor, opposite the Oakhurst meeting suite. It holds the defibrillator, spare supplies and a rest couch. Team assistants are expected to know its location so they can direct visitors or staff quickly in an incident. The room is unlocked whenever a trained first-aider is on site; check the rota on the kitchen noticeboard. Outside those hours the door is secured, and assistants can open it using the duty access code.

turnstile pass: bdg-NG-3

Test plan: Renderloft transcoding farm, cycle 14.

Cover: 4K HDR ingest, mid-job node loss, queue backpressure at 500 concurrent jobs, and codec fallback on malformed input. Pass bar: zero corrupted outputs, recovery under 90s. Load scripts run nightly against the staging farm. Job submissions in staging authenticate with the token below.

login token, bagug-kafop: eyJhbGciOiJIUzI1NiIsInR5cCI6IkpXVCJ9.eyJzdWIiOiIcMLov2In0.Z5RLDIfp

Subject: Warranty-Cost Overrun — Aldertide Series

Team,

Warranty claims on the Aldertide pump series ran 23% over reserve this quarter, driven mainly by seal failures in units shipped from the Corvane plant between March and May. Engineering has isolated the fault to a gasket batch and a field-repair program is underway. Expect a reserve adjustment in next month's close. Please hold related accruals until the adjustment posts. Further context on our response follows below.

board note of fahag-tajop: The eastern region missed its Julix quota by 44.0 percent last quarter. Ralionax Holdings plans to lower the Druath list price by 61.8 percent in March. The board signed off on a budget of $295.0 million for Project Gilath. The renewal with Ruswynix Systems closes at $274.5 million a year, 17.0 percent above the last contract.

Finance Review — Kestwell Pilot. Quick one for the sales leads: the pilot with the Kestwell retail chain came in slightly under budget, with sell-through beating forecast by 12%. Margins held despite promo pricing on the Brindlet line. Inventory turns look healthy. Nice work keeping fulfillment tight. The strategic note on next steps sits below.

confidential, bahap-bajog: Zorethix Works is in early talks to buy Kelethox Foods for about $30.7 million. The Ralvan launch date is September 19, and nothing goes to the press before then.